A lot of electrical contractors learn their trade in a 4- or 5-year apprenticeship program. For each year of the program, apprentices typically obtain 2,000 hours of paid, on-the-job training along with some technological instruction. Workers who acquired electric experience in the military or in the construction market may receive a shortened apprenticeship based on their experience and testing.
